#263ED9 Color
#263ED9 is rgb(38, 62, 217) in RGB, hsl(232, 70%, 50%) in HSL, and about cmyk(82%, 71%, 0%, 15%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Palatinate Blue (#273BE2),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 6.54. White text is the more readable choice on this background.

#263ED9 Channel Values
How #263ED9 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 38 · G 62 · B 217 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 232° · S 70% · L 50%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 232° · S 82% · V 85%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 82% · M 71% · Y 0% · K 15%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 7.57:1 vs white · 2.77: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#263ED9 background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#263ED9 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#263ED9?
#263ED9 is a mid-tone blue — rgb(38, 62, 217) in RGB and hsl(232, 70%, 50%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Palatinate Blue (#273BE2),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 6.54.
What is the RGB value of #263ED9?
#263ED9 is rgb(38, 62, 217) — red 38, green 62, and blue 217 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#263ED9?
#263ED9 converts to approximately cmyk(82%, 71%, 0%, 15%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#263ED9 be black or white?
White text is the more readable choice. #263ED9 scores 7.57:1 against white and 2.77: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#263ED9 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#263ED9 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is mediumslateblue (#7B68EE) at a CIE76 distance of 23.95, which is visibly different.
